Why You Need Water Shoes
Before we get into the specifics of size 14, let’s talk about why water shoes are a must-have for any water enthusiast. Water shoes offer several key benefits:
- Protection: Water shoes shield your feet from sharp rocks, shells, and other underwater hazards that can cause cuts and injuries. Imagine walking barefoot on a rocky beach – ouch! Water shoes eliminate that worry.
- Traction: Many water shoes come with specialized outsoles that provide excellent grip on slippery surfaces. This is essential for activities like kayaking or paddleboarding where maintaining balance is key.
- Comfort: Quality water shoes are designed to be comfortable, even when wet. They often feature quick-drying materials and cushioned insoles to keep your feet happy.
- Hygiene: Water shoes protect your feet from bacteria and fungi that can thrive in wet environments. Public pools and beaches can harbor unwanted germs, and water shoes provide a barrier.
Choosing the right pair of water shoes means you can focus on enjoying your favorite activities without worrying about discomfort or potential injuries. They’re an investment in your safety and comfort, making every water adventure more enjoyable.
What to Look for in Men's Water Shoes Size 14
Okay, guys, let's get down to business. When you're shopping for men's water shoes in size 14, there are several factors you should keep in mind to ensure you get the best fit and performance:
1. Accurate Sizing
This might seem obvious, but it’s worth emphasizing: make sure the shoes are actually size 14! Sizes can vary between brands, so it’s a good idea to check the manufacturer’s sizing chart before ordering. If possible, try the shoes on in a store to confirm the fit. A shoe that's too small will be uncomfortable and restrict movement, while one that's too large can slip off and cause blisters.
2. Material
The material of your water shoes is crucial for comfort and durability. Look for quick-drying materials like neoprene, mesh, or synthetic fabrics. These materials will prevent the shoes from becoming waterlogged and heavy, and they’ll also reduce the risk of chafing. Avoid materials that absorb a lot of water, as they can become uncomfortable and take a long time to dry.
3. Sole and Traction
The sole of your water shoes should provide excellent traction on wet and slippery surfaces. Look for rubber outsoles with a textured pattern that will grip the ground. Some water shoes also feature siped soles, which have small cuts that help to channel water away from the foot and improve traction. A good sole will give you the confidence to navigate slippery rocks, boat decks, and pool edges without losing your footing.
4. Comfort and Support
Even though water shoes are designed for wet environments, they should still be comfortable to wear. Look for features like cushioned insoles, arch support, and a snug fit that won’t slip or rub. Some water shoes also have adjustable straps or closures that allow you to customize the fit. Remember, you might be wearing these shoes for hours at a time, so comfort is key.
5. Durability
Water shoes can take a beating, so it’s important to choose a pair that’s built to last. Look for reinforced stitching, sturdy materials, and a well-constructed sole. Check reviews to see how other users have rated the durability of the shoes. Investing in a high-quality pair of water shoes will save you money in the long run, as they’ll be less likely to fall apart after just a few uses.

Tips for Maintaining Your Water Shoes
To keep your men's water shoes size 14 in top condition, follow these simple maintenance tips:
- Rinse after each use: After wearing your water shoes, rinse them thoroughly with fresh water to remove any salt, sand, or chlorine. This will prevent the materials from deteriorating and keep the shoes smelling fresh.
- Dry properly: Allow your water shoes to air dry completely before storing them. Stuffing them with newspaper can help to absorb moisture and speed up the drying process. Avoid placing them in direct sunlight or near a heat source, as this can damage the materials.
- Clean regularly: Every few weeks, give your water shoes a more thorough cleaning with mild soap and water. Use a soft brush to scrub away any dirt or grime. Rinse well and allow to dry completely.
- Store properly: When not in use, store your water shoes in a cool, dry place away from direct sunlight. Avoid storing them in a damp or humid environment, as this can promote the growth of mold and mildew.
By following these maintenance tips, you can extend the life of your water shoes and keep them performing their best.
